## Transformer Configurations - CRD
This tutorial shows how to add transformer configurations to support a CRD type.
Create a workspace by
<!-- @createws @test -->
```
DEMO_HOME=$(mktemp -d)
```
### Get Default Config
Get the default transformer configurations by
<!-- @saveConfig @test -->
```
kustomize config save -d $DEMO_HOME/kustomizeconfig
```
The default configurations are save in directory `$DEMO_HOME/kusotmizeconfig` as several files
> ```
> commonannotations.yaml commonlabels.yaml nameprefix.yaml namereference.yaml namespace.yaml varreference.yaml
> ```
### Add Config for a CRD
All transformers will be involved for a CRD type. The default configurations already include some common fieldSpec for all types:
- nameprefix is added to `.metadata.name`
- namespace is added to `.metadata.namespace`
- labels is added to `.metadata.labels`
- annotations is added to `.metadata.annotations`
Thus those fieldSpec don't need to be added to support a CRD type.
Consider a CRD type `MyKind` with fields
- `.spec.secretRef.name` reference a Secret
- `.spec.beeRef.name` reference an instance of CRD `Bee`
- `.spec.containers.command` as the list of container commands
- `.spec.selectors` as the label selectors
Add following file to configure the transformers for the above fields
<!-- @addConfig @test -->
```
cat > $DEMO_HOME/kustomizeconfig/mykind.yaml << EOF
commonLabels:
- path: spec/selectors
create: true
kind: MyKind
nameReference:
- kind: Bee
fieldSpecs:
- path: spec/beeRef/name
kind: MyKind
- kind: Secret
fieldSpecs:
- path: spec/secretRef/name
kind: MyKind
varReference:
- path: spec/containers/command
kind: MyKind
- path: spec/beeRef/action
kind: MyKind
EOF
```
### Apply config
Create a kustomization with a `MyKind` instance.
<!-- @createKustomization @test -->
```
cat > $DEMO_HOME/kustomization.yaml << EOF
resources:
- resources.yaml
namePrefix: test-
commonLabels:
foo: bar
vars:
- name: BEE_ACTION
objref:
kind: Bee
name: bee
apiVersion: v1beta1
fieldref:
fieldpath: spec.action
EOF
cat > $DEMO_HOME/resources.yaml << EOF
apiVersion: v1
kind: Secret
metadata:
name: crdsecret
data:
PATH: YmJiYmJiYmIK
---
apiVersion: v1beta1
kind: Bee
metadata:
name: bee
spec:
action: fly
---
apiVersion: jingfang.example.com/v1beta1
kind: MyKind
metadata:
name: mykind
spec:
secretRef:
name: crdsecret
beeRef:
name: bee
action: \$(BEE_ACTION)
containers:
- command:
- "echo"
- "\$(BEE_ACTION)"
image: myapp
EOF
```
Use the cusotmized transformer configurations by adding those files in kustomization.yaml
<!-- @addTransformerConfigs @test -->
```
cat >> $DEMO_HOME/kustomization.yaml << EOF
configurations:
- kustomizeconfig/mykind.yaml
- kustomizeconfig/commonannotations.yaml
- kustomizeconfig/commonlabels.yaml
- kustomizeconfig/nameprefix.yaml
- kustomizeconfig/namereference.yaml
- kustomizeconfig/namespace.yaml
- kustomizeconfig/varreference.yaml
EOF
```
Run `kustomize build` and verify that the namereference is correctly resolved.
<!-- @build @test -->
```
test 2 == \
$(kustomize build $DEMO_HOME | grep -A 2 ".*Ref" | grep "test-" | wc -l); \
echo $?
```
Run `kustomize build` and verify that the vars correctly resolved.
<!-- @verify @test -->
```
test 0 == \
$(kustomize build $DEMO_HOME | grep "BEE_ACTION" | wc -l); \
echo $?
```
